This Easy Low Carb Skillet Cheesy Corn BBQ-Style is famous in Kansas City. Just like Kentucky has its red slaw and Texas has its beans, this …

Reviews: 1Category: Side DishCuisine: BBQTotal Time: 15 mins1. Adjust oven rack to 6 inches from top broiler element.
2. In a large oven-proof skillet on medium heat, stir together the corn, riced caulilfower, 1/4 cup of the bacon crumbles, ham, sour cream and cream cheese, granulated garlic, smoked paprika, salt, pepper and cayenne, breaking up the cream cheese while stirring all the ingredients together. Cook until the cream cheese is melt and the mixture just begins to bubble at the edge (8-10 minutes)
3. Off heat, stir in 1 cup of cheddar cheese and stir until cheese has melted. Top skillet with remaining cheese and 2 tbsp of remaining bacon crumbles.
4. Turn the broiler on "Hi" and place the skillet under the broiler until the cheese begins to brown brown (about 3 minutes).
